ISO 9001: Quality Management Systems
ISO 9001 is a globally recognized standard for quality management. It helps organizations of all sizes and sectors to improve their performance, meet customer expectations and demonstrate their commitment to quality. Its requirements define how to establish, implement, maintain, and continually improve a quality management system (QMS).

ISO 27001: Operation Resilience
ISO/IEC 27001 is the world's best-known standard for information security management systems (ISMS). It defines the requirements an ISMS must meet. The ISO/IEC 27001 standard provides companies of any size and from all sectors of activity with guidance for establishing, implementing, maintaining and continually improving an information security management system.

ISO 14001: Environmental Management System
ISO 14001 is the internationally recognized standard for Environmental Management Systems (EMS). It provides a framework for organizations to design and implement an EMS, and continually improve their environmental performance.

ISO 13485 : Medical Devices
ISO 13485:2016 specifies requirements for a quality management system where an organization needs to demonstrate its ability to provide medical devices and related services that consistently meet customer and applicable regulatory requirements

ISO 28004: Security Management Systems for Supply Chain Management
ISO 28004:2007 provides generic advice on the application of ISO 28000:2007, Specification for security management systems for the supply chain. It explains the underlying principles of ISO 28000 and describes the intent, typical inputs, processes and typical outputs for each requirement of ISO 28000. This is to aid the understanding and implementation of ISO 28000

ISO 42001: Information Technology - Artificial Inteligence
ISO/IEC 42001 is an international standard that specifies requirements for establishing, implementing, maintaining, and continually improving an Artificial Intelligence Management System (AIMS) within organizations. It is designed for entities providing or utilizing AI-based products or services, ensuring responsible development and use of AI systems.

ISO 45005: Occupational Health and Safety Management
ISO 45005 gives guidelines for organizations on how to manage the risks arising from COVID-19 to protect work-related health, safety and well-being.

Phase 2 - ITU Y.4904
Smart Sustainable Cities Maturity Model. It measures 91 points to be considered such as: Wifi access, roadways, hospitals, utilities, trash, electrical grid, safety, and other important infrastructure components.
